What to Get Your Baby for Christmas:
Baby toys – First of all, it is Christmas, and children are known for getting toys even if they’re babies. Check out what baby toys are available for your little one’s age, and see which ones got the best ratings and consider those! They must be good if they have good ratings.
Books – It’s never too early to start reading to your baby. They like to listen, look around, and like the calming feeling of a story read to them before bed. Books are great, and babies love them!
Clothes – Your little one can never have too many clothes especially when they get the ones they have dirty, and they grow out of them so soon. Get them some nice outfits even if it’s for the next upcoming months. You won’t have to worry about them later.
Prepare – Prepare for the future. What will your little one need soon? Maybe they need a new car seat since they’re growing, some new supplies, or even something as simple as a play crib so they can walk around outside and can’t get out. Babies need never ending supplies, you might as well prepare for the future if you don’t know what else to get them.
Their future – You can also think of their future. My parents got me savings bonds when I was just a baby. I thought it was great because I was able to cash them in when I was 18, and I didn’t even know I had them. When your baby turns into an adult the thing they want most is money!
